Just throwing a few ideas out there…

Maybe a weekly or fortnightly Members interview? Say choose members at random and interview them via email and have it as a regular article. Good way to get to know members and their snowboarding/skate/surf experiences and insights

Professional/amature Riders profiles and/or interviews - again interviews similar to some mags do that are short and entertaining and gives a view into their lifes. Would be good to hear from local Aus and NZ riders on their seasons or how they go in comps etc.

Resort “Spot Checks” -  dont know how possible this is but maybe a video of each resort (Aus/Nz) through out the season showing a run through the park set ups, or a featured run. I suppose this could be covered in a way by the on mountain bloggers that you have arranged this season. They will obviously be able to give more ongowing updates of their respective hills.

Indistry based articles - so as well as articles there is on riding/progression/tuning etc you could maybe have people in the Industry do articles about their areas. Say for example from boardworlds sponsors, have someone from each one do an article on burton board making, or whats going on in grenade gloves world, or a feature by 3cs, etc..
You could also extend this to areas of snowboarding like photography and filming. Could be done blog style or feature article style on how they work, what the benifits of workin in the industry, bla bla bla lol
